Review
Fate has drawn Hart and Gracen together through the most bizarre and upsetting circumstances--he's a demon, and she's the Abomination. Can they find a way to save the world and have something left for themselves?
I'm so sad to see this series end. Not only will I miss the amazing characters, I'll miss the unique and compelling storyline. No matter how dire the situation seems for Gracen and Hart, there's always a twist I never see coming.
But what I've loved the most through each book is the detailed inner struggle of both Hart and Gracen, and Reckless continues this intense introspection. And I couldn't wait to see how Kelly Martin would bring this epic tale to a conclusion. I'm excited to say it doesn't disappoint, even though I never could have guessed it.
I highly recommend this series!!

Breathless by Kelly Martin (5 stars)
About Breathless
(Heartless #3)
There's good.
There's evil.
Then there's her.
When Gracen Sullivan stabbed Hart Blackwell, she thought it was over. She thought the world was safe--safe from her. Stuck in the Abyss, watching as the evil inside her body takes over, she has to find some way to stop it.
Hart Blackwell expected to wake up in Hell. Instead, he woke up in his grave. With the world falling apart, he has to put the bad history with his brother in the past or there will be no future.
Armageddon has been set in motion. Enemies will have to work together or everything will end in fire and brimstone.
The Abomination is here. And she must be stopped no matter the consequences.

Review
Unique and captivating only begins to describe the Heartless series. Gracen and Hart are two characters whose destinies are intertwined. Their decisions could have devastating ramifications for all of humanity.
That love got in the way only makes the story that much sweeter.
In Breathless, we learn more about Hart and his brother while also getting further perspective from Gracen, as she discovers details about herself and her role in what happens to the world.
Nothing is ever quite what it seems, and twists and turns abound. Far be it from me to give anything away, because it's too entertaining to read the book and find out for yourself. For those emotionally raw from the last book, this will continue to tear at your heart... especially since we get an even more intimate view of Gracen and Hart than ever before.
I highly recommend this series, like shout-it-from-the-rooftops recommend. If you love intriguing plot twists and awesome characters, look no further.

Review
Grace Sullivan can't help who she is, and as much as she might want to, she may not be able to help what she's about to do. Of course, the one man she somewhat trusts, and who somewhat has the answers, has more than one life to consider.
Vague much?
Maybe it's because this is a book you truly have to experience for yourself. As the second in the Heartless series (and I would highly recommend reading Heartless first), Soulless further tests the ideas of good and evil, and what someone would be willing to sacrifice to stop the worst from happening.
Gracen struggles with impossible choices, trust issues (from her boyfriend to her own mother), and what it takes to survive. Trust me when I say you won't be able to put this book down once you start. It's an intense and emotional ride. One that'll have your cringing one moment and crying the next.
In the midst of all this, you'll find yourself pulling for Gracen to find a way out of her fate, to find love (with the man who helped put her in the situation she's in), and above all, to survive.
A mind-bending, intense, and truly unique read. 5 very enthusiastic stars!

Heartless by Kelly Martin (5 stars)
About Heartless
Some things can't be saved.
What would you do if your guardian angel wasn't sent to protect you from the world but to protect the world from you?
For thirteen years, Gracen Sullivan dreamed about a red-eyed demon named Hart Blackwell who tortured her every night. Her mother freaked when she found out about her daughter's "hallucinations" and forced Gracen to go to the doctor, who prescribed some very powerful medication which kept Hart out of her head for five years.
A week ago, Hart came back and brought a friend.
But something has changed, and Gracen is seeing Hart when she's awake too. And the other "friends" in her dreams? They have been found dead.
The police want to talk to her.
Her boyfriend has become distant.
Her dreams are becoming more and more intense.
Hell wants her. Heaven has to stop her.
When push comes shoving, can Gracen fight the evil eating away inside her or will she be forced to embrace it and destroy the world?

Review
Gracen Sullivan has been fighting to have a semblance of a normal life for as long as she can remember. With intense medication, she kept her nightmares at bay... but Hart (her dream tormentor) is back, and things will never be the same.
Now, she's not the only one in her dreams, and the visitors keep turning up dead. As Gracen's dreams grow in intensity, she realizes her nightmares have spilled over into her reality. Police are involved and angels and demons are pursuing her.
Her biggest question... is she the evil she's come to fear?
First, I have to give huge props to author Kelly Martin for writing such a unique story and having the guts to do so. In real life, good and evil are not always clearly defined. In Heartless, Gracen struggles to figure out where she stands. And we, as readers, get to be in her head and feel her torment.
The story will hook you from the first page and hold you in its grips until the very last word. It's a roller coaster of emotions and intrigue. Just as soon as you think you know what's going to happen, things will turn upside down.
All the main characters in this story have a compelling background. I love how their struggles stretched my thinking, leaving me questioning my own rules about right and wrong... about what makes us do what we do.
I only wish I could tell you more... but I don't want to spoil anything by giving too much away.
If you are looking for a unique and captivating read, one that will test your idea of good and evil, then pick up a copy of Heartless today.

Betraying Ever After by Kelly Martin (5 stars)
About Betraying Ever After
The first time Vaughan Wexley, Earl of Brighton, eyes the blonde beauty from atop the balcony, he is taken. Once he confronts her, he finds himself in love. The mysterious woman seems out of place in the regular sea of husband nabbing debutantes. She posses a gentle spirit, wide-eyed innocence, and-- his favorite quality-- cascading golden waves around her elegant shoulders. In need of a wife of noble blood, Vaughan believes his search has ended.
Emma Hartwell's only mission at the ball is to deliver a message to the host from her employer. In and out. That's the plan until she sees beautiful sights she's only dreamed of and hears wonderful music that touches her soul. Dressed up as a noble woman by the young housemaid Elizabeth and knowing she'll never get this opportunity again, Emma lingers longer than she intended. Her amazement with the grandeur allows the devilishly handsome Lord Brighton to steal her attention and sweep her off her feet. He is a charming man who is obviously taken with her. Emma's heart doesn't stand a chance. If only she could tell him the truth.
An earl in need of an honorable wife.
A servant in love with a man she can't have.
An evil plan that was set in motion years ago coming to fruition.
Can love conquer betrayal? Or will Emma's fairytale end at midnight?
A Cinderella re-telling.
Review
Emma Hartwell is being held responsible for a debt that is not hers, by a madman who lives for a long-planned revenge. After a simple mission for him, she runs into Vaughan. They are drawn to each other immediately, but neither understands the pawns they play in a wicked game.
Who doesn't love a fairy tale? Emma is a great character. She's caught in a situation beyond her control, but she's trying to make the best out of it. She's not off sulking in a corner and having a pity party.
Vaughan is a man used to getting what he wants. Emma is the first time there's an obstacle in his way. At first, he's really taken aback, but ultimately he doesn't hesitate to follow his heart.
I was rooting for them from the moment they first spoke to one another. And now I can't wait to read The Beast of Ravenston. There are a few characters from this book that will be featured, and I'm eager to find out what happens.
This is a wonderful read anytime of year, but especially in the summer. It's charming and emotional, and you won't be able to put it down.
